>Bill & Dave,
>
>You just have to look for them. Check eBay. Post notes to all of the
>(appropriate) email lists you're a member of, etc. Be sure you know
what the two
>variants (PL-P103 straight and PL-Q103 right angle) look like so that
(a) you
>can spot one at a flea and (b) you don't buy a standard Jones connector
by
>mistake.
>
>The shock mount/rack is FT-154. NOSB they do not include the connector,
>which was requisitioned separately because of the two options. But used
racks
>often do. They turn up every now and again in all the usual places.
>
>I don't have any racks or connectors at present. Maybe some other list
>member does and just hasn't gotten around to mentioning it.
